Joseph HICKOCK was born 3 July 1645 in Farmington, New Haven Colony
Joseph HICKOCK was the child of William HICKOCK and Elizabeth STACYS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Joseph married Mary CARPENTER abt. 1673 in Connecticut Colony .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Mary CARPENTER was born 1 August 1650 in Farmington, Connecticut, USA (Unionville). Mary died 3 February 1687 in Connecticut, USA. Mary was the child of David CARPENTER and Elizabeth UNKNOWN.
Joseph HICKOCK died 12 August 1687 in Farmington, Connecticut Colony .
